Description
If you’re an experienced carer looking for short-term and weekend respite work around Cowes, PrimeCarers connects you directly with local families who need cover from a few hours to a few days. You’ll work with people who want a reliable break from family care, whether for an afternoon, an overnight or a weekend. Right now, 3 families are currently looking for care in the wider area.
Respite work in Cowes and across the Isle of Wight often includes companionship, personal care, medication prompting, support with meals and light household tasks. Shifts vary: people book a few hours in the evening, daytime cover while a relative has appointments, or short stays for weekend rest. You decide which kinds of visits you’ll accept and which areas you’ll travel to, including nearby towns such as East Cowes, Lee on the Solent, Ryde, Fareham, Gosport and Brading.
Carers on PrimeCarers are self-employed and set their own rates. Typical pay for this role is £18.80–£22 per hour; the platform also shows more detailed ranges such as £18.80–£22 per hour for hourly care and £148–£165 per day for live-in days when applicable. You pick your rate, your clients and your hours — that flexibility suits carers who want to leave agency rotas behind and take control of the work-life balance.
PrimeCarers finds carers clients and handles contracts, invoicing and payments, with insurance included while they work. That means you can focus on care rather than paperwork. We also support arranging an Enhanced DBS if you need one, and we verify references so families can book with confidence.
To join you’ll need at least one year of professional care experience, an Enhanced DBS check (or allow us to help arrange one), the right to work in the UK and verifiable references. What carers earn around Cowes
Carers on PrimeCarers are self-employed and set their own rates. Typical ranges are based on what carers in the area currently charge.
Hourly care
Based on 41 carers in the area
£18.80–£22 per hour
Overnight care
Based on 33 carers in the area
£17–£20 per hour
Live-in care
Based on 1218 carers in the area
£148–£165 per day
